Telecommunications horizontal cabling systems definition

Telecommunications horizontal cabling systems means the portions of the telecommunications cabling system that extend from the work area telecommunications outlet or connector to the telecommunications closet. The horizontal cabling includes the horizontal cables, the telecommunications outlet or connector in the work area, the mechanical termination, and horizontal cross- connections located in the telecommunications closet.
